Louise F. (Fleming) Smith, 93 years, died Friday July 11, 2003 at the Copley at Stoughton Nursing Home after a brief illness. She was born and raised in Stoughton, a daughter of the late Edward J. and Frances (Bunn) Fleming. She was a graduate of Stoughton High School and had been a secretary for Avon Sole Company for many years. After her retirement she and her husband moved to St. Petersburgh, FL for several years. She had also been a resident of Belair Towers for 25 years. She was an avid Bingo player.
She is survived by one daughter, Janet Bent of Norwell, MA, one son Kenneth R. Smith of Weymouth, four grandchildren, six great grandchildren, one nephew, and a sister Evelyn Golden of St. Petersburgh, FL. She was the wife of the late Richard W. Smith. A graveside service will be held at Melrose Cemetery at a later date.
